Summary

Five Republican Minnesota state senators plan to introduce a bill classifying “Trump Derangement Syndrome” (TDS) as a mental illness, defining it as “acute paranoia” about Trump’s presidency.

The bill argues TDS causes hysteria, verbal hostility, and aggression toward Trump supporters.

Critics argue this represents a dangerous politicization of mental health diagnoses that could suppress political expression.

The bill will be read Monday before the Minnesota Senate Health and Human Services Committee, where Democrats hold a narrow majority.
